Stem and method for acquiring MRI data from bone and soft tissues |
摘要 |
A system and method for producing MR images in which bone and soft tissue are identified. The method includes applying a pulse sequence that includes a first stage configured to acquire a radially-encoded FID and radially-encoded echoes performed after a non-selective RF excitation pulse and before a second stage, which is configured to acquire additional echoes. The radially-encoded MR data acquired during the first stage is substantially representative of bone, while the MR data acquired during the second stage is substantially representative of soft tissues. MR images in which bone and soft tissue are identified are reconstructed from these MR data sets. |

主权项 |
1. A method for producing a magnetic resonance (MR) image that depicts both bone and soft tissue, the steps of the method comprising:
a) directing a magnetic resonance imaging (MRI) system to perform a pulse sequence a plurality of times, wherein each repetition of the pulse sequence includes:
a) i) producing a non-selective radio frequency (RF) pulse;a) ii) acquiring during a first stage of the pulse sequence:
an MR signal from a free-induction-decay having an ultra-short echo time using a radial k-space trajectory; andat least one MR signal from at least one echo occurring after the free-induction decay using a radial k-space trajectory; anda) iii) acquiring during a second stage of the pulse sequence that occurs after the first stage of the pulse sequence, a plurality of MR signals from echoes occurring after the at least one echo occurring in step a) ii); and b) producing an MR image that depicts both bone and soft tissue by:
b) i) reconstructing an image that depicts substantially only bone from the MR signals acquired in the first stage of the pulse sequence;b) ii) reconstructing an image that depicts soft tissues from the plurality of MR signals acquired in second stage of the pulse sequence; andb) iii) combining the images reconstructed in steps b) i) and b) ii) to produce the MR image depicting both bone and soft tissue. |
